Research teams : Madrid - Universidad Complutense de Madrid,Facultad de Farmacia
Authors : Ferrandez J, Sanchez R, Diaz D, Diaz M, Estevan M, Garcia T.
Title : Stability of daptomycin reconstituted vials and infusion solutions.
Reference : EJHP ; 25: 107-110. 2018

Level of Evidence : 
Level of evidence C
Physical stability : 
Visual examination 
Chemical stability : 
High Performance Liquid Chromatography - Diode Array detector (HPLD-DAD)
High Performance Liquid Chromatography - ultraviolet detector (HPLC-UV)
Stability defined as 95% of the initial concentration
Other methods : 
PH measurement Water loss by evaporation 
Comments : 
Degradation products not observed in real conditions
Results with high coefficient of variation or not provided, or lack of duplicate analysis of each point

List of drugs
InjectionDaptomycin Antibiotic
Stability in solutions Glass Sodium chloride 0,9% 50 mg/ml 2-8°C Protect from light
7 Day
Stability in solutions Glass Sodium chloride 0,9% 50 mg/ml 25°C Protect from light
2 Day
Stability in solutions Polypropylene Sodium chloride 0,9% 14 mg/ml 2-8°C Protect from light
7 Day
Stability in solutions Polypropylene Sodium chloride 0,9% 14 mg/ml 25°C Protect from light
4 Day
Stability in solutions Polypropylene Sodium chloride 0,9% 5,6 mg/ml 2-8°C Protect from light
7 Day
Stability in solutions Polypropylene Sodium chloride 0,9% 5,6 mg/ml 25°C Protect from light
2 Day
